Description:
  • Assists the teacher(s) in achieving teaching and learning objectives working with individual students or small groups.
  • Assists the teacher(s) in implementing strategies for reinforcing skills based on a sympathetic understanding of individual students, their needs, interests, and abilities.
  • Works with individual students or small groups of students to reinforce the learning of skills or content initially introduced by the teacher.
  • Assists the teacher(s) with the management and supervision of students in the classroom to ensure a safe and productive learning environment.
  • Communicates with and alerts the teacher to any problems or special information related to the students.
  • Maintains the same high level of ethical behavior and confidentiality of information about students as is expected of teachers.
  • Assists the teacher(s), when appropriate, with such activities as drill work, reading to students, listening to students read, guiding independent study, enrichment work, and remedial work.
  • Participates in training programs, as assigned.
  • Assists with the supervision of students, and other duties in the school, as assigned by the Principal.
  • Requirements:
  • All instructional assistants must have a Paraprofessional (Short-Term License
    * is available for candidates with a high school diploma or the equivalent), Professional Educator or a Substitute Teaching License from the Illinois State Board of Education. This approval is based on meeting one of the following:
    • Completion of 60 semester hours of college credit.
    • Completion of a paraprofessional training program approved by ISBE or ICCB.
    • Passage of the ETS Parapro Assessment, or
    • Passage of the applicable ACT Work Keys assessments.
  • Experience working with students in a learning center atmosphere preferred.
  • Illinois elementary teaching certificate preferred.
  • Ability to speak foreign language/Spanish preferred.
  • Be able to communicate well with children and parents.
  • Ability to follow directions.
  • Work well with adults.
